AN ARTIFICIAL MOLECULAR RECEPTOR MOLECULE FOR DITOPIC ANIONS
Schmidtchen, F. P.
, p. 1987 - 1990 (1986)
The synthetic strategy to connect two macrotricyclic ammonium salts of different sizes (1,2) to give the ditopic receptor 9 is described.A host-guest complexation analysis reveals that the binding of 13 in contrast to the analogues 10-12 involves interactions with either tetrahedral subsite of 9.The ditopic receptor 9 discriminates between 12 and 13 by a factor of 3 relative to the monotopic host 2.
A NOVEL ENZYME MIMIC FOR THIAZOLIUM-CATALYZED α-KETOACID DECARBOXYLATION
Bergmann, N.,Schmidtchen, F. P.
, p. 6235 - 6238 (2007/10/02)
The covalent combination of the thiazolium heterocycle of thiamine with macrotricyclic quaternary ammonium receptor units yields the enzyme mimics 3a,b, which show enhanced substrate selectivity and catalytic activity in decarboxylations of α-ketoacids compared to simpler salts lacking the receptor substructure.
